Land grading services involve the leveling and shaping of a property's ground surface to ensure proper drainage, stability, and functionality. This process typ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low areas, and contouring the land to achieve a desired slope.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to create a smooth, even surface that can support future construction, landscaping, or other outdoor projects. Proper land grading is essential for establishing a solid foundation for various types of property development and ensuring long-term usability.

One of the primary problems land grading helps address is water drainage. Improperly graded land can lead to water pooling, erosion, and flooding, which may damage structures or hinder landscaping efforts. By adjusting the slope and surface elevation, land grading services help direct water away from buildings and critical areas, reducing the risk of water-related issues. Additionally, grading can prevent soil erosion and uneven settling, which can compromise the stability of the property over time.

Properties that commonly utilize land grading services include residential yards, commercial sites, and agricultural fields. Residential properties often require grading to prepare for new construction, patios, or lawns, ensuring proper runoff and a level foundation. Commercial properties benefit from grading to create safe, accessible parking lots and building sites. Agricultural land may be graded to improve water distribution and prevent erosion, supporting healthier crop growth. Regardless of the property type, proper grading contributes to a safer, more functional outdo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Land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lagrange,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Land Grading - The cost typ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 for standard projects. This includes leveling small areas or preparing a yard for landscaping or construction. Prices vary based on the size and complexity of the site.

Intermediate Land Grading - For more extensive grading work, costs often fall between $3,000 and $7,000. This may cover larger properties or projects requiring significant excavation and contouring. Additional features like drainage may influence the price.

Heavy Land Grading - Larger or more complex grading projects can cost $7,000 to $15,000 or more. These jobs often involve substantial earthmoving, slope stabilization, or preparing land for development. The scope of work impacts the final cost significantly.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, soil stabilization, or erosion control measures. These can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ars depending on project requirements and local regulations. Contact local pros for det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is land grading? Land grading involves leveling or sloping the land surface to improve drainage, prevent erosion, and prepare the site for construction or landscaping projects.

Why is land grading important? Proper land grading helps manage water runoff, reduces soil erosion, and creates a stable foundation for buildings or other structures.

How do I find local land grading services? You can contact local contractors or service providers who specialize in land grading to discuss your project needs and get assistance.

What factors affect land grading costs? Costs can vary based on the size of the area, the complexity of the grading work, and the type of equipment required.

How long does land grading typically take? The duration depends on the scope of the project, but a professional contractor can provide an estimate based on your specific site conditions.
